Why hidden fire risks demand more than standard fittings

Many buildings contain concealed pathways where heat, smoke, and flames can travel unnoticed—especially around penetrations, service routes, and voids. When fire-resistance details are incomplete, even minor gaps can undermine compartmentation and reduce the effectiveness of a whole passive fire strategy. The result is a higher likelihood of rapid fire spread, greater smoke migration, and avoidable compliance exposure Specialized Fire Protection during inspections. At the core of the problem is uncertainty: contractors may use generic materials or incomplete specifications, leaving variations across floors, walls, and building zones. A robust approach requires engineers and installers who can translate legislative requirements into practical, buildable solutions for each unique junction and structure.

Precision-driven cavity barrier work that withstands inspection scrutiny

Cavity barriers are a key part of protecting concealed spaces, but they must be installed correctly to prevent leakage paths from forming. Poor alignment, incorrect materials, rushed curing, or inadequate sealing at interfaces can all compromise performance. A compliance-first method focuses on correct specification, careful preparation of substrates, and controlled installation details that maintain continuity across building elements. For complex structures, expert teams also coordinate with architects and engineers to align fire strategy drawings with site reality, helping ensure the final build matches the design intent. Where needed, an effective service will support clear records, test evidence alignment, and a quality control mindset that reduces remedial work.
